Digital Only Token definition

Digital Only Token or “DOT” shall mean the Digital Only Token field as described in the Specification, used to trigger the limitation of output or recording of Decrypted DT Data.
Digital Only Token means the field, as described in the Specifications, used to trigger the limitation of output of Decrypted AACS Content to only digital outputs. Note to Adopter: Content Participants and Content Providers are permitted to set the Digital Only Token for AACS Content only pursuant to Part 3, Section 1.2 of these Compliance Rules.

Examples of Digital Only Token in a sentence

  • A Source Device shall not set the Digital Only Token to DOT asserted except where the encoding upstream from the Source Device directs the Source Device to assert the Digital Only Token in the Source Device.

  • Notwithstanding the terms of Section 2.2-2.4, with respect to Digital Only Token Content, the copy protection technologies referenced in Section 2.2.1.1 shall be deemed further restricted to only those copy protection technologies, if any, approved by DTLA for Digital Only Token Content, now or in the future, as specified on the DTLA website or in a notice to Adopter.
